About Fnac-Darty France
Fnac-Darty is a household name in France, covering electronics, books, music, appliances, and more through its two flagship brands. Sending this card gives your recipients in metropolitan France the freedom to choose between shopping in a Fnac or Darty store, ordering on fnac.com, or booking travel at a Fnac Voyages agency. That breadth makes it a safe default when you don't know the recipient's preferences: almost everyone in France finds something useful here.
The card is available in fixed amounts of 10, 25, 50, 70, or 100 EUR per card, with a minimum single card value of 5 EUR and a maximum of 250 EUR if you need a different amount. It expires 6 months after delivery, so recipients should plan to use it within that window. Note that while the card itself has a 6-month validity, the security PIN needed to activate it expires 12 months from delivery; the PIN expiry doesn't extend the card's own expiry.
Recipients can spend the balance in one transaction or across several, up to the card's value, and can combine it with another payment method if a purchase costs more than the remaining balance. Redemption works in Fnac and Darty stores, on fnac.com (excluding travel, press subscriptions, photo printing, and Marketplace sellers), and at Fnac Voyages agencies, all within metropolitan France. The card cannot be used for those excluded categories, so if your recipients are likely to want travel books, magazine subscriptions, or third-party Marketplace items, a different card might be safer.
